Major fundraiser launched to complete vital renovations


A MAJOR fundraiser hopes to raise €30,000 to complete vital renovations to the Coole Cranford Community Centre. This initiative comes after a €300,000 funding award from Pobal, requiring the community to match €30,000 to bring this project to fruition.
